Job Description:An ideal SOA tester would have the analytical skills and awareness to validate the engine's results.SOA tester will provide the support in developing SOA/integration interface test plans and estimates, automated test script development, executing service test scripts, reporting/tracking defects. The tester may also contribute to functional testing as needed by the team. The Quality Engineer is responsible for managing quality and test related process execution with high impact to the business. This includes providing feedback on artifacts developed during requirements and analysis phase within RaaS and other R&D projects, authoring test plans and test automation, and performing test execution for both project and support related activities. Test web services using CA Lisa / DevTest automated scripts. Test web services using SDLC best practices. Participate in all phases of API / Integration / web services system testing. Develop, implement and maintain quality and test procedures, processes and best practices for QA. Develop and maintain test plan and test scripts with associated test data based upon functional and non-functional requirements. Identify test automation opportunities to improve efficiency and effectiveness of testing services. Contribute to test automation scripting standards and best practices. Elicit & understand SOA testing requirements. Write automation scripts and participate in peer reviews. Develop a repeatable process for designing, developing, and executing scripts. Conduct tests, document and analyze test results and present findings to development teams. Report and document defects found during test cycles. Participate in defect prioritization sessions. Work with development teams to instill testability into development practices. Provide test services for support activity and work with release management to assure product release quality. Communicate timely status, including any potential risks/issues to the appropriate teams to ensure completion of all deliverables within schedule, budget and quality constraints.
